I made a bracket for my 1812 because of the boom i made on the back. It is made out of 1/4 flat stock and one peice of 1/8 for support brace.It attachs to factory bolt like the undercarrige bolt on the side of the frame and and bolts into two holes in the fram near the front.006.jpg
